Popcorn is a widely enjoyed, flavorful snack that’s also rich in fiber. It’s produced by heating kernels of a specific type of corn called Zea mays everta, which causes pressure to build inside the kernel until the starch expands and it bursts open. Even though it’s a tiny organ, the gallbladder can develop problems. While conditions affecting the gallbladder range in seriousness, some may contribute to sensations of abdominal bloating. You might notice some short-term weight loss after your gallbladder is taken out. Maintaining that weight change over time depends on eating a balanced diet and keeping active. Some studies indicate that particular essential oils might ease heartburn, a symptom linked to digestive disorders like g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D). Still, the body of evidence is sparse.
